At the recent COP26 conference in Glasgow, nearly 200 countries presented plans to drastically reduce their carbon emissions by 2030 in an effort to keep global warming to 1.5 degrees – the maximum amount scientists say is acceptable to prevent the worst impacts of climate change. Globally, the world is on a mission to reach net-zero by 2050, but it won’t be possible through government action alone, businesses and individuals also need to do their part.
